Cannot deploy on Galaxy Tab 10.1 with 5.0
To reproduce:
Build anything (even an empty project) on Galaxy Tab 10.1.
On 4.x it builds fine
On 5.0 it doesn't work, throwing this message:
"Failure to initialize!
Your hardware does not support this application, sorry!"
